Transaction 168fe032f96cbee70e53f840b78dd32b4d11ae701b7b627c4879f66223af0bcc

1 Input
2 Outputs
  • 168fe032f96cbee70e53f840b78dd32b4d11ae701b7b627c4879f66223af0bcc:0
  • value  130000000
    address  2N8NMjgBbakgExLiNmZDEPcrUTBxEAQQ5WK
  • 168fe032f96cbee70e53f840b78dd32b4d11ae701b7b627c4879f66223af0bcc:1
  • value  5003594315
    address  mpZzDbBPujAmnVmiRydojFZbVZmsN6rwyN